3) Discuss the following with the class and post the answers on your blog :-

a) Explain the difference in the sizes of the two tiff files in steps 1) and 2).

LZW is a lossless compression. That is it compresses the size of the file without loss of data using a lookup algorithm.

b) When saving a jpeg file what two things change when you select a different quality factor?

Size of the file and quality of the image that limits the ability to enlarge. It also reduces the colour values as you select lower quality factors.

c) What is ‘dithering’ and why is it used ?

The positioning of different coloured pixels within an image that uses a 256-colour palette to simulate a colour that does not exist in the palette. A dithered image often looks 'noisy', or composed of scattered pixels. Google definition viewed 28 March 2011 <publications.europa.eu/vademecum/vademecum/9313fdfe-c49e-119e-45c6a6441e63e066_en.html>

d) Explain the difference in size between the greyscale tiff file and the original tiff file.

The greyscale is an 8 bit file while the original is a 24 bit file (8 bit per channel).
